2018 Nissan Qashqai At The 2017 Detroit Auto Show?

Nissan is getting ready to introduce one more crossover in North America. According to the newest rumors, the popular carmaker will try to fill the gap between the Rogue and Juke with the 2018 Nissan Qashqai. The solution is quite simple and maybe very good because the Qashqai is currently one of the best-selling European Nissans. The only thing that the manufacturer may reconsider to change is the name. We are pretty sure that the vast majority of Americans can’t pronounce accurately “Qashqai”, and this is bad for business.

The US-specs 2018 Nissan Qashqai will reportedly arrive at the 2017 Detroit auto show. This isn’t too complicated at all, because the current model came redesigned last year, so there is no need for any big preparations. The North American model could get some mild styling changes and perhaps some new color options, but nothing else new, at least not from the outside. The interior should get a more glamorous design, especially the base model, which could feature some new cues and better equipment.

The US Nissan Qashqai will definitely appear without diesel engines. In Europe, the crossover gets 1.5-liter and 1.6-liter diesel, but this is too much for Americans. The producer will rather offer the existing gasoline mill, which is a 1.6-liter naturally aspirated and 1.2-liter turbo, and perhaps one more, more powerful unit. Perhaps the range-topping model could get a new turbocharged, 2.0-liter, four-cylinder VC-T engine. The drivetrain is really something, so the US 2018 Qashqai might become very popular right away.

As we said, the US 2018 Nissan Qashqai will appear at the upcoming Detroit auto show, and if this actually happens, we will have more information about the interesting crossover in the coming days.
